Output c8da956df7aed17c4e39feca636edf096f21143fda4fae15d120bdb140f529c8:0

value
1103955
script pubkey
OP_0 OP_PUSHBYTES_20 eebdb3454d88f2971b7b4c86dc027be3a0b0660c
address
bc1qa67mx32d3refwxmmfjrdcqnmuwstqesvdt4cty
transaction
c8da956df7aed17c4e39feca636edf096f21143fda4fae15d120bdb140f529c8
confirmations
2633
spent
true